Disqualification <br />may also take place according to the following considerations: <br />a. Companies with pending litigation may be disqualified for <br />the duration of litigation as deemed to the advantage of the <br />city by the city's project manager. <br />b. There is a default on the contract, or forfeiture of bid bonds <br />or performance bonds. <br />C. There is a performance record of poor workmanship on <br />previous projects. <br />d. There is a performance record of failure to complete <br />warranty work. <br />e. There has been a bankruptcy or financial reorganization. <br />f. Companies submitting consolidated financial statements <br />will be disqualified unless their parent company agrees to <br />be the contracting party with the city." <br />Section 3.
